Optimize Sleep, Heighten Fat Loss

When it comes to shedding those extra pounds, you might be focused on hitting the gym and monitoring your calories. But what about sleep? It's often overlooked, but getting enough quality rest is absolutely essential for effective fat loss. When you snooze, your body releases hormones that regulate appetite and metabolism. Consistently skimping on sleep can throw off this delicate balance, leading to increased cravings and a slower metabolism. Aim for 7 hours of quality sleep each night to enhance your fat loss progress.

Fuel Your Fitness Through Deep Slumber

A good night's slumber is often overlooked when it comes to fitness success. However, it plays a vital role in muscle recovery, hormone regulation, and overall energy levels. When you lack your body of enough sleep, you limit your ability to perform at your best. Conversely, consistent deep rest can boost your strength, endurance, performance.

Your body uses this time to mend muscle tissue damaged during workouts and synthesize essential hormones like growth hormone, which is crucial for muscle growth. Moreover, adequate sleep encourages cognitive function, helping you make better decisions and stay focused during your workouts.

By prioritizing deep slumber, you can truly maximize your fitness journey and achieve your goals more successfully.
